Material Matters

Breeo firepits are crafted from high-quality, weather-resistant materials like 304 stainless steel, which is known for its durability and resistance to rust. This underlines the firepit’s ability to retain heat effectively, ensuring that you feel the warmth without excessive smoke.

Airflow Design

Another significant feature that impacts heat generation is the airflow design. Breeo firepits incorporate a patented system that promotes optimal airflow, allowing the fire to burn hotter and more efficiently. This helps reduce smoke and increases the intensity of the heat produced.

Temperature Ranges

The operating temperature of a Breeo firepit can depend on several factors including the fuel used, the size of the fire, and environmental conditions. Generally, a fully fueled Breeo firepit can reach temperatures of up to 1,000°F (538°C), making it extremely hot.

Using Wood vs. Charcoal

The type of fuel you choose has a direct impact on the heat generated.

  • Wood: Using seasoned hardwood can produce a consistent flame and maintain higher temperatures.
  • Charcoal: This option can also generate high heat but may require more management to keep the temperature consistent.

Heat Zone and Safety Considerations

Understanding the heat zone around your firepit is important. The area immediately surrounding the fire pit can get extremely hot, especially the top edges.

Safe Distances

To maximize enjoyment while ensuring safety, it’s wise to maintain a distance of at least 3 feet from the firepit when seated. Children and pets should be supervised to avoid any burns from accidental contact with hot surfaces.

How long does the Breeo Firepit take to reach desired temperatures?

The Breeo Firepit typically takes about 10 to 15 minutes to reach desired temperatures after lighting the fire. This timeframe can vary depending on factors such as the type of wood used, the size of the logs, and the weather conditions. Using dry, seasoned wood will contribute to a faster and hotter burn, while wet or green wood may take longer to ignite and reach optimal temperatures.

Once the fire is established, users can enjoy a robust and consistent heat output. Many users note that the Breeo Firepit heats up more efficiently than traditional fire pits, allowing for quicker gatherings around the fire, whether for warmth or cooking purposes.
